Former Liverpool player and current TalkSPORT pundit Graeme Souness has expressed confidence in Manchester City’s ability to emerge victorious in their upcoming clash against league leaders Arsenal. Souness, when asked for his prediction, confidently stated that he believes City will come out on top.
However, his co-pundit Simon Jordan was slightly less certain, suggesting that the game could result in a draw, with Arsenal having the potential to secure a crucial victory that could put them in a strong position to challenge for the title.
The outcome of Sunday’s match carries significant implications for both teams. A win for Arsenal would see them go four points clear at the top of the table, while a victory for City would provide them with a much-needed boost as they enter the final stretch of the season.
Despite dropping points to some of the league’s top teams at home this season, City have managed to remain unbeaten at the Etihad Stadium. With a seemingly favorable run-in ahead of them, including matches against teams in the bottom half of the table, Guardiola’s side will be aiming to maintain their momentum and finish the campaign strongly.
While the road ahead may present challenges, City’s superior form against teams in the bottom half of the table bodes well for their title aspirations. The focus for Guardiola and his team will be on securing a convincing win against Arsenal this weekend and setting themselves up for a successful end to the season.
